Iconic indie rock act Clap Your Hands Say Yeah today announce a world tour in November 2025, celebrating the 20-year anniversary of their landmark self-titled debut album. The tour will include founder and frontman Alec Ounsworth performing the album in its entirety alongside other surprises, and an exclusive new reissue.
Clap Your Hands Say Yeah will start the Australian / New Zealand leg of the anniversary tour in Sydney at Metro Theatre on November 5, before heading to Northcote Theatre in Melbourne on November 7, The Triffid in Brisbane on November 8, and wrapping up in Auckland at The Tuning Fork on November 11.
